Ordinals
beta
Sat 808763286951911
decimal
161752.3286951911
degree
0°161752′472″3286951911‴
percentile
38.51253751626433%
name
icughwfyuek
cycle
0
epoch
0
period
80
block
161752
offset
3286951911
timestamp
2012-01-11 21:45:54 UTC
rarity
common
prev
next